Do WW collectors care about Chase pieces?

Postby Z_from_TX » Thu Nov 12, 2015 7:32 pm

Let me start off my saying I am very new to collecting Funko toys. I came across 2 Chase WW Sheldon and Leonard from Big Bang Theory. I looked them up on poppriceguide and they were not on there. All the other pieces didn't seem like they were going for that much either. Are WW not that popular?

Re: Do WW collectors care about Chase pieces?

Postby FunkoNewb » Fri Nov 13, 2015 2:56 pm

WW are not As popular. But to answer your first question, ww collectors like their pieces the same way as pop collectors. It's just a different market with a smaller audience. I love the chase wobblers for my marvel pieces, a nice shiny chrome base looks awesome.
